Jim Manly (Old Greenwich, CT): Great job on the Kelly Holcomb signing. My question is about tight end. We have two guys with serious injuries and an offense that badly needs another option. Is there anyone in the draft (2nd round) or free agency we should look out for?

TD: Both Mark Campbell and Tim Euhus are projected to be at full speed by training camp. There have been significant improvements in knee surgeries and rehab over the last 10 years. Our tight end position produced 37 receptions last year and we are looking to improve that this season. We are re-signing Ryan Neufeld today. Ryan was an outstanding player in our system last year and did a good job as a tight end and an H-back and also made a significant contribution on special teams. We will also look in the draft at the position to see if we can improve in our production from our tight ends.

Bryan Ault (Alexandria, VA): As fans, we do not have a lot of confidence in Rian Lindell's distance and we think he puts additional pressure on the offense to get closer late in close games. How do you intend to address the kicking situation in the off-season? Thanks for your time.


TD: Our philosophy as an organization is to always try to improve the team in all areas. Sometimes, however, you should watch what you wish for. Rian Lindell improved as much as any player on our team last year compared to the 2003 season. He ended the year near the top of most statistical categories in the NFL. For example, in 2003 he was 17-of-24 kicking field goals for a total of 75 points. In 2004, he was 24-of-28 on his field goals for 117 points. He also lost two long field goals last year when we called timeout prior to the kicks which he made. Rian is improving and has done a very good job under the direction of Bobby April. We expect him to take another step this season as our kicker.
